The cheetah (Acinonyx jubatus) is a large cat and the fastest land animal. It has a tawny to creamy white or pale buff fur that is marked with evenly spaced, solid black spots. The head is small and rounded, with a short snout and black tear-like facial streaks.

It reaches 67-94 cm (26-37 in) at the shoulder, and the head-and-body length is between 1.1 and 1.5 m (3 ft 7 in and 4 ft 11 in. Cheetah, one of the world's most-recognizable cats, known especially for its speed. Cheetahs' sprints have been measured at a maximum of 114 km (71 miles) per hour, and they routinely reach velocities of 80.

A cheetah's footprints have claw tips visible, more like a dog's than like a typical cat's print. Cheetahs have very low levels of genetic variation compared to other mammals, making them susceptible to disease. The cheetah is a daylight hunter that benefits from stealthy movement and a spotted coat that allows it to blend easily into high, dry grasses.
